#' Compute t-statistic map with or without Empirical Bayes.
#'
#' Compute t-statistic map with or without Empirical Bayes.
#'
#'
#' @param V Matrix of voxels intensities (rows are voxels, columns are
#' subjects).
#' @param design Design matrix for the covariates of interest, with rows
#' corresponding to subjects and columns to coefficients to be estimated.
#' @param columnIndex Numeric indicating which covariate of the design matrix
#' should be considered.
#' @param weights Non-negative observation weights. Can be a numeric matrix of
#' individual weivhts, of same size as the voxel matrix, or a numeric vector of
#' subject weights with length equal to 'ncol' of the voxel matrix, or a nmeric
#' vector of voxel weights with length equal to 'nrow' of the voxel matrix.
#' @param brain.mask Path of a NIfTI file mask to specify subset of voxels for
#' which the t-statistics should be computed.
#' @param eBayes Should the limma Empirical Bayes method be used to compute
#' moderated t-statistics?
#' @param output.file Filename of the NIfTI file to be saved to disk,
#' containing the computed t-statistics.
#' @param returnObject Should the t-statistics be returned as a matrix?
#' @param writeToDisk Should the t-statistics image be saved to the disk?
#' @param verbose Should messages be printed?
#' @param ... additional arguments to pass to \code{\link{lmFit}}
#' @return If \code{returnObject} is \code{TRUE}, a matrix of the t-statitics
#' is returned, and if \code{writeToDisk} is \code{TRUE}, the t-statistics
#' image is saved to disk as a NIfTI file.
#' @author Jean-Philippe Fortin
#' @importFrom limma lmFit eBayes
